Ordinals
beta
Address 15EGsTGtXFbPhLDGcA6WMLoRgKhdN8958J
sat balance
1669
outputs
766c667eb6fe8e250f211bd51bd01fc09db60bf220ba8ffc22ba86fea054be87:0